1. Ashwagandha
Ashwagandha, also known as Withania somnifera, is an adaptogenic herb revered in Ayurvedic medicine. It helps the body manage stress and promotes overall mental well-being.
Health Benefits of Ashwagandha
- Reduces Stress and Anxiety: Several studies show that ashwagandha can lower cortisol levels, the stress hormone.
- Enhances Cognitive Function: This herb may improve focus and memory, making it popular among students and professionals.
- Supports Immune Health: Regular use can strengthen the immune system.
How to Use Ashwagandha
Ashwagandha is available in various forms including capsules, powders, and teas. It's recommended to take it daily for optimal results.
2. Turmeric
Turmeric, or Curcuma longa, is a golden spice well-known for its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. This herbal powerhouse is often used as a supplement for various health issues.
Health Benefits of Turmeric
- Anti-inflammatory Effects: Curcumin, the active compound in turmeric, can help reduce inflammation in the body.
- Improved Joint Health: Many people find relief from arthritis symptoms with turmeric supplementation.
- Boosts Digestive Health: Turmeric can aid in digestion and improve gut health.
How to Use Turmeric
Turmeric can be consumed as a spice in food, as a tea, or taken as a supplement. For enhanced absorption, combine it with black pepper.
3. Echinacea
Echinacea, often referred to as coneflower, is popular for its immune-boosting properties. It is widely used to prevent or reduce the duration of colds and other respiratory infections.
Health Benefits of Echinacea
- Supports Immune Response: Echinacea enhances the production of white blood cells, which plays a crucial role in fighting infections.
- Reduces Inflammation: This herb can help alleviate inflammation related to health conditions.
- Helps with Respiratory Conditions: Echinacea is often used to relieve symptoms of colds and flu.
How to Use Echinacea
Echinacea is available in capsules, teas, tinctures, and extracts. For best results, it's advisable to start taking it at the first sign of illness.
4. Ginger
Ginger, scientifically known as Zingiber officinale, has a long history of use for its medicinal properties. This rhizome is well-known for its ability to combat nausea and inflammation.
Health Benefits of Ginger
- Helps with Digestive Issues: Ginger is effective in alleviating various gastrointestinal discomforts.
- Reduces Nausea: It is particularly helpful for morning sickness during pregnancy and motion sickness.
- Anti-inflammatory Properties: Gingercan reduce muscle soreness and inflammation after intense exercise.
How to Use Ginger
Ginger can be consumed fresh, dried, powdered, or as an oil or juice. Including it in your diet through teas, smoothies, or using it in cooking can provide numerous health benefits.
5. Peppermint
Peppermint (Mentha piperita) is not just a refreshing flavor; it is also packed with health benefits. Its active ingredient, menthol, offers various therapeutic effects.
Health Benefits of Peppermint
- Relieves Digestive Issues: Peppermint oil is widely used to alleviate indigestion and bloating.
- Eases Headaches: Inhaling peppermint oil can provide relief from tension headaches and migraines.
- Enhances Respiratory Function: It can help relieve sinus congestion and enhance airflow.
How to Use Peppermint
Peppermint can be consumed as tea, applied topically as oil, or used in culinary dishes. For headaches, a few drops of peppermint oil mixed with a carrier oil can be massaged onto the temples.

What are medicinal herbs and how do they work?
Medicinal herbs are plants used for their therapeutic properties. They contain bioactive compounds that may influence various biological processes in the body, helping to alleviate symptoms or treat conditions.
How do I choose the right medicinal herb for my needs?
Choosing the right herb depends on your specific health concerns. It is advisable to consult with a healthcare provider or a herbalist to tailor a solution best suited for your needs.
Are there any side effects associated with medicinal herbs?
While many medicinal herbs are safe for the majority of people, some may cause adverse effects, especially when interactions with medications occur. Always consult a healthcare professional before starting any new herbal regimen.
